Like A Photographer With His Camera, John Berger Uses Words To Capture Moments: Preserving Them, Denying Their Inherent Transience. A Passing Encounter, An Almost Unnoticed Gesture, A Brief Pauseberger Observes And Transcribes Them, And In So Doing Uncovers The Extraordinary Heart Of The Ordinary. This Collection Of Stories Brings A Richly Imagined Landscape Of Elusive And Ephemeral Moments Into Eloquent Existence.
